详解Vue-基本标签和自定义控件
分享优质内容:Vue基础标签与自定义控件介绍
今天,我们将深入Vue这一强大的前端框架。作为长沙网络推广的重要分享内容,我将详细介绍Vue的基础标签和自定义控件,希望能为大家的开发工作带来启示和帮助。
一、Vue基础标签介绍
Vue框架提供了丰富的内置标签,使得开发者能更轻松地构建复杂的用户界面。这些基础标签涵盖了表单元素、布局组件、导航链接等多种类型。其中,像v-model、v-if等指令标签,为数据绑定和条件渲染提供了强大的支持。它们不仅易于理解,而且在实际开发中非常实用。
二、自定义控件的实现
除了基础标签,Vue还允许我们创建自定义控件,以满足特定的业务需求。通过组件化的开发方式,我们可以将复杂的界面拆分为多个独立的组件,每个组件都可以拥有自己的数据和逻辑。这样一来,不仅提高了代码的可维护性,还使得团队协作更加高效。
在自定义控件时,我们可以利用Vue的混入(mixins)、插槽(slots)和生命周期钩子等功能。这些高级特性使得我们可以创建出功能丰富、复用的组件。Vue的组件系统还提供了良好的性能优化机制,确保我们的应用能在各种环境下流畅运行。
三、长沙网络推广的独特见解
长沙网络推广团队对Vue的研究和应用有着独到的见解。他们认为,掌握Vue的基础标签和自定义控件是前端开发的重要一环。通过分享这篇文章,他们希望更多的开发者能够了解并熟悉Vue,从而在工作中取得更好的成绩。
Vue框架为我们提供了强大的工具来构建用户界面。无论是基础标签还是自定义控件,都能帮助我们创建出功能丰富、性能优越的应用。作为长沙网络推广的推荐内容,Vue值得我们深入学习和应用。希望大家能从这篇文章中获益,并将其作为参考,为自己的项目开发带来更多灵感。跟随长沙网络推广的步伐,让我们一起Vue.js的神奇世界!
在上一篇文章中,我们已经完成了环境的搭建和默认内容的运行。这篇文章,我们将学习一些常用的Vue标签,如按钮、列表、逻辑判断、用户输入以及自定义控件等。
Vue.js的页面结构非常简单明了,主要由三部分组成:index.html是我们的页面,main.js是连接App.vue和页面的“挂载js文件”,而App.vue则是我们具体的Vue代码。
Vue本身对实际的DOM进行了一层封装,我们的渲染等一系列行为其实都是在“虚拟DOM”上进行操作,然后只会刷新需要刷新的部分,而不是整体刷新,这也是Vue性能较好的一部分原因。
就像React的render函数内渲染ui控件一样,Vue在一个标签下写自己的内容。比如:
```html
{{ msg }}
```
在这里,msg是一个带值的引用,而不是一个字符串'msg',它的值来源于data{}下的属性msg。
接下来,我们尝试一些更复杂的操作。比如按钮:
```html
export default {
name: 'app2',
data () {
return {
message: 'Hello Vue.js!'
}
},
methods: {
showlog: function () {
console.log(this.message)
}
}
}
```
在这里,我们用v-on来响应onclick事件,将时间交给一个方法showlog来处理,这个方法会在控制台打印出message的值。
列表在Vue中的实现方式和普通H5几乎没有区别,值也是从data{}里返回的。比如:
```html
- {{ list.text }}
export default {
name: 'app2',
data () {
return {
items:[
{ text : '123'},
{ text : '234' },
{ text : '345' },
{ text : '10086'}
]
}
}
}
```
这里用到了v-for指令来遍历列表。当集合中的数据发生变化时,页面上的列表也会自动更新。还有v-if指令用于逻辑判断,当v-if的值为false时,对应的标签将不会显示。用户输入则可以通过v-model指令实现双向数据绑定。我们还尝试制作了第一个自定义控件,并在app.vue中调用它。这些知识点涵盖了Vue.js的一些基本用法和特性。如果你对这些内容感兴趣并想深入学习,请继续跟随我们的脚步,一起Vue的世界!在编程的世界里,当我们谈论控件的初始化和加载时,我们必须明确一个核心原则:如果存在子控件和父控件的概念,那么子控件的初始化和加载一定要放在首要位置。这是一种基础而重要的编程逻辑,关乎程序的流畅运行和用户体验的优化。
想象一下,我们正在建造一座大厦,父控件就像是那座大厦的框架,而子控件则是填充框架的砖瓦。如果我们不先搭建起稳固的框架,那么后续的砖瓦又该如何安放呢?同样的道理,如果子控件没有得到适当的初始化,那么整个程序可能会出现各种问题,如运行缓慢、崩溃等。
当我们深入这一章节的内容时,会发现其背后蕴含的是对细节的关注和对技术的尊重。简短而精炼的内容,背后是开发者们无数次的实践和摸索。每一个看似简单的步骤,都可能是经过深思熟虑的结果。
在这里,我们要感谢那些为技术世界贡献智慧和力量的开发者们。他们的努力和创新,为我们带来了更好的学习资源和工具。就像狼蚁SEO一样,他们用自己的行动告诉我们:即使是最微小的进步,也值得我们去努力追求。
教程的这一章节虽然简短,但却蕴含着丰富的知识和智慧。希望大家能够从中受益,掌握这一重要的编程原则。也希望大家能够给予狼蚁SEO更多的支持和鼓励,让更多的人分享到优质的学习资源。
这一章节的核心观点是:在编程中,子控件的初始化和加载是不可或缺的重要步骤。只有掌握了这一原则,我们才能更好地编写出流畅、稳定的程序,为用户提供更好的体验。而这背后,是开发者们对技术的热爱和追求,以及对细节的关注和对用户的尊重。
平面设计师
- 详解Vue-基本标签和自定义控件
- nodejs 图解express+supervisor+ejs的用法(推荐)
- 原生实现一个react-redux的代码示例
- 基于JQuery+PHP编写砸金蛋中奖程序
- Bootstrap组合上、下拉框简单实现代码
- 简单学习5种处理Vue.js异常的方法
- ASP.NET GridView中加入RadioButton不能单选的解决方案
- 纯jQuery实现前端分页功能
- 基于vue-simplemde实现图片拖拽、粘贴功能
- JS 面向对象之继承---多种组合继承详解
- PHP实现微信对账单处理
- js简单实现竖向tab选项卡的方法
- Javascript中的匿名函数与封装介绍
- js中开关变量使用实例
- AngularJS Bootstrap详细介绍及实例代码
- javascript实现获取浏览器版本、操作系统类型